Description

Traditionally, every spring L’Occitane en Provence launches a fragrance inspired by cherry blossom depicting mesmerizing spring atmosphere. For spring 2015 the new collection was introduced, which arrives on the market with awakening of spring. The collection abounds in natural scents and colorful landscapes from Southern France, Luberon region, winning us over with sweet fruity cherry aroma blended with a gentle and feminine bouquet.

L`Occitane en Provence Fleurs de Cerisier L`Eau reveals lush cherry blossom on tree branches while air is filled with freshness of lemon, black currant and water melon in top notes. The heart of the composition develops cherry blossom, rose, orchid and white flowers, while the base features shades of warm wood and sensual musk.

The perfume is available as 50ml Eau de Toilette. The collection encompasses gel fragrance paced as 14ml, perfumed body milk 250ml, perfumed shower gel 250ml, perfumed hand cream 30ml and perfumed lip gloss12ml. The collection can be expected on the market in the beginning of February 2015.
